Subject: [PATCH 19/28] hazptr: Permit detaching hazard pointers from contexts

Provide a new hazptr_detach() function that detaches a given hazard
pointer from its acquisition context. This context might be a task or
an interrupt handler.

+/* Internal helper. */
+static inline
+void hazptr_promote_to_backup_slot(struct hazptr_ctx *ctx, struct hazptr_slot *slot)
+{
+ struct hazptr_slot *backup_slot;
+
+ backup_slot = hazptr_chain_backup_slot(ctx);
+ /*
+ * Move hazard pointer from the per-CPU slot to the
+ * backup slot. This requires hazard pointer
+ * synchronize to iterate on per-CPU slots with
+ * load-acquire before iterating on the overflow list.
+ */
+ WRITE_ONCE(backup_slot->addr, slot->addr);
+ /*
+ * store-release orders store to backup slot addr before
+ * store to per-CPU slot addr.
+ */
+ smp_store_release(&slot->addr, NULL);
+ /* Use the backup slot for context. */
+ ctx->slot = backup_slot;
+}
+
+static inline
+void hazptr_detach(struct hazptr_ctx *ctx)
+{
+ struct hazptr_slot *slot;
+
+ guard(preempt)();
+ slot = ctx->slot;
+ if (unlikely(hazptr_slot_is_backup(ctx, slot)))
+ return;
+ hazptr_promote_to_backup_slot(ctx, slot);
+}
